St. Agnes is known as the Patron Saint of Young Virgins. Born in the early 4th century in Rome, St. Agnes was a young girl who dedicated her life to serving God and preserving her virginity. Despite facing persecution and even death for her beliefs, she remained steadfast in her faith until the very end.

St. Agnes is often depicted with a lamb, symbolizing her purity and innocence. She is also celebrated for her courage and unwavering devotion to God, making her a role model for young virgins around the world.

St. Agnes is celebrated on January 21st each year, with many churches holding special services and prayers in her honor. This day is a time to reflect on her legacy and seek her intercession for purity and grace in our own lives.
